Responsibilities

Peraton requires Wireless Network Administrators to support the Special Operation Command Information Technology Enterprise Contract (SITEC) - 3. Positions are located at the SOCOM Headquarters at MacDill, AFB FL, and at the TSOC and Component locations in the United States and abroad.

The purpose of the Special Operations Forces Information Technology Enterprise Contract

(SITEC) 3 Enterprise Operations and Maintenance (EOM) Task Order (TO) is to provide

USSOCOM, its Component Commands, its Theater Special Operations Commands (TSOCs),

and its deployed forces with Operations and Maintenance (O&M) services to maintain Network Operations (NetOps); maintain systems and network infrastructure; provide end user and common device support; provide configuration, change, license, and asset management; conduct training, and perform Install, Move, Add, Change (IMACs) services. The responsibilities and tasks associated with each requirement play a pivotal role to USSOCOM, the CIO/J6 organization, and ultimately the end-user who operate around the globe 24x7x365.

Wireless Network Administrators perform tier three wireless network support in accordance with the SIE OPORD. This position requires strong analytical and problem-solving skills, and must be knowledgeable about both wired and wireless network technology. A background in wireless equipment, standards, protocols, and security standards, as well as wireless local area network (WLAN) design is necessary. Wireless Network Administrators must also be effective communicators with excellent written, verbal communications, and presentation skills in order to collaborate successfully with network technicians, vendors, and managers. Wireless Network Administrators should also demonstrate leadership skills and excellent customer interaction skills.

Duties include but are not limited to:

    Planning, designing, and implementing wireless networks, including the definition of applicable engineering specifications and resource requirements for network hardware and software
  • Performing systems engineering, design, analysis, and maintenance of wireless and wired networks
  • Providing recommendations for wireless network optimization, additions and upgrades to meet Government requirements
  • Conducting and documenting radio frequency (RF) coverage and site surveys
  • Documenting network infrastructure and design
  • Some positions may require shift work and/or an ability to work a non-standard work schedule to support the USSOCOM mission
Qualifications

Required qualifications:

  • BS and 5 years of experience, MS and 3 years of experience, or PhD and 0 years of experience, or a High School Diploma or equivalent and 9 years of experience.
  • A DoD security clearance at the TS or higher level is required.
  • CCNA or CWNA certification
